  • NEW ALBUM: GAYLE | A STUDY OF THE HUMAN EXPERIENCE VOLUME ONE - EP

    GAYLE has released her highly anticipated debut EP entitled "A Study of the Human Experience Volume One," the singer-songwriter’s first-ever studio effort via Arthouse Records/Atlantic. The EP, as a whole, is a summation of Gayle’s experiences as a teen, filled with lessons learned and failed friendships. And though they’re all specific to her own life, ultimately, they capture how “life is fucking weird,” she says. “And life is so hard, but it’s so lovely simultaneously. And that’s really confusing." Especially when you’re growing up.” GAYLE burst onto the scene after releasing “abcdefu” back in December, which spelled out fuck you’s to her ex, his mom, and his shitty Craigslist couch. The track topped Billboard‘s Emerging Artists chart as the deliciously profane pop-rock kiss-off went viral. Since then, the 17-year-old Nashville native has landed at the apex of both the Alternative Streaming Songs and Alternative Digital Song Sales before reigning supreme on Billboard’s Global 200 and the Global Excl. U.S. chart. Thus far, the global hit has peaked at No. 3 on the Billboard Hot 100 after 14 weeks of steady momentum, despite competing with the juggernaut that is "Encanto‘s" “We Don’t Talk About Bruno.” Meanwhile, GAYLE’s world domination has continued with the launch of Billboard’s new Hits of the World charts, where it’s currently at No. 1 in Austria, Germany and Luxembourg, and in the Top 10 in numerous other countries. Ahead of her coming EP release, GAYLE has maintained a steady stream of promotion for her fledgling career as a superstar-in-the-making, having already made her late-night debut by performing on "The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on," announcing a headlining tour, covering Alanis Morissette‘s “You Oughta Know,” oh, and trading DMs with none other than Olivia Rodrigo.

  • NEW ALBUM: NICHOLAS MCCHOPPIN | LOVERBOY (HEARTTHROB EDITION)

    New York-based, queer pop star singer-songwriter Nicolas McCoppin has released a deluxe repackage of his 2020 EP, "Loverboy (The Heartthrob Edition)" via Loverboy Recordings, AWAL/Kobalt Music Group. Led by US radio Top 40 single ‘Heaven,’ “Loverboy (The Heartthrob Edition)” shares the classic tale of queer love and heartbreak. The record is packed with infectious yet heartfelt hooks; this project solidifies McCoppin as a trailblazer in the next generation of pop. In 2021, McCoppin made his official US radio debut with ‘Heaven’ the lead single from the forthcoming project. Ten weeks after Nicolas McCoppin’s initial chart introduction, “Heaven” broke Top 40 on the Mediabase Activator Chart at #40 with national radio, fan support, and 200,000 on-demand streams. ‘Heaven’ continues to climb higher each week with rave reviews from station programmers across the US. When you take a new generation of young, queer producers and writers and pair them with industry veterans like Bonnie McKee (Katy Perry, Britney Spears, Kesha), the result is a project like Loverboy (The Heartthrob Edition).

  • NEW ALBUM: TREY FOREVER | HEARTBREAKS DON'T LAST FOREVER

    St. Louis-based R&B recording artist Trey Forever returns with a fresh EP titled "Heartbreaks Don't Last Forever." Trey Forever decides to keep things short and sweet with this 2-track body of work in an effort to give listeners a taste of what's to come. Consisting of the self-produced songs, "You Bad" and "All For You," Trey Forever croons over dark, atmospheric vibes that have become quite popular in today's R&B. With the first day of Spring right around the corner, Trey Forever's "Heartbreaks Don't Last Forever" is a much-welcomed change in temperature, even though Winter is still very much here. Hailing from the cityscapes of St. Louis in Missouri, R&B recording artist Trey Forever has been hitting the ground running in the music industry relentlessly since 2016 and has captivated thousands of fans and listeners since coming out of the gate, including over 1 million SoundCloud. His versatile style became apparent when he dropped his debut single “Drunk Conscious” shortly after coming out the gate, which garnered Trey Forever critical acclaim and positive reception in the R&B scene. Shortly after, the rising Singer quickly motivated to drop his follow-up single Heal and “Drunk Conscious” Music Video. With mainstream sensibilities and an ambition to truly make his way to the top, Trey Forever has more considerable prospects down the line to make sure he remains completely active, authentic, and attention-grabbing as a recording and performing artist. He's currently gearing up for a radio tour slated for 2018.

  • NEW ALBUM: MADISON OLDS | DROWNING IN MY THOUGHTS

    Although 2020 produced one of the most trying time spans for independent artists in recent memory, Vancouver-based singer Madison Olds managed to overcome the odds and quickly transcended into a bonafide pop music sensation. Olds proves that on her new EP titled "Drowning In My Thoughts," she has a knack for penning delicious pop songs. Olds scored a radio hit this year with the disc’s opener, “Best Part of Me,” which reached the top 30 of several Mediabase and Billboard charts, including #22 on Billboard’s Emerging Canadian Artist chart. Its funky follow-up, “If You Wanna,” furthers the fun. “3’S a Crowd” feels like a video game arcade in a Caribbean setting. “Cliché of Falling in Love” nicely sets up an irresistibly bouncy chorus. Madison enters into a duet with Josh Ronen on the beautiful ballad “Sorry.” Finishing off with the fresh and satisfying “All the Small Things” and playful bop “Bad Thing." More recently, Olds was the recipient of the iHeart Radio Future Star of the Month, and over the past few months, her TikTok account has blown up to the tune of almost 500,000 followers. Although Olds’ star continues to rise, she maintains a genuine, down-to-earth authenticity while utilizing her newfound stardom to advocate for important issues such as stem cell research.

  • NEW ALBUM: ASHLYNN MALIA | RATHER BE ALONE (EP)

    Nineteen-year-old Los Angeles-based artist Ashlynn Malia has been writing songs for most of her youth, some of which was spent doing a three-year stint as a singer and dancer with the Kidz Bop troupe. What she’s doing now is no child’s play as she releases her debut EP, “Rather Be Alone." “We played around, experimented a lot, and didn’t take ourselves too seriously during the process,” says Malia. “A ton of the sounds you hear in this EP are original. Looking back at the start of this project, we’ve all evolved so much since. We poured our time, energy, hearts, and souls into this body of work, and it’s extremely personal and special.”Made over the past two years with producers Andrew Weitz and Koby Berman, the EP reveals a singer finding her own voice. And on “Open,” her vocals are nuanced, ebbing and flowing in a spacious arrangement as she lyrically pulls the curtain back on some relatable insecurities. Malia, who debuted with the single “Desperate” almost two years ago and has progressed from there, has grown her profile over the years with a trove of acoustic covers she posts online, as well as her dancing and choreography work. (She did the choreography on Emily Kinney’s latest video, and here she is dancing to “Driver’s License”).
